About Edinburgh (EDI)

The capital of Scotland and the second largest city after Glasgow, Edinburgh is undeniably one of the most beautiful cities in the world. Often called as the Athens of the North, this wonderful city is blessed with mountainous landscapes, tall trees, wonderful flower gardens, gurgling rivers and stunning lochs. Here, there are many attractions that can keep tourists engaged for days. Some of which are the Water of Leith - a trout stream, Arthur's Seat - an extinguished volcano, Calton Hill - a viewpoint and Duddingston Loch - the ideal place for bird-watching in Scotland. Edinburgh is divided into many districts, and some of the most popular ones are Leith, Stockbridge and Canonmills, New Town, Old Town, and Portobello. Old Town and New Town, both listed as UNESCO World Heritage Sites, are dotted with historical and modern edifices. The presence of North Sea on the eastern side of Edinburgh has blessed it with several beautiful beaches, as well. West Sands, Yellowcraigs, Peace Bay and Gullane are some of the most gorgeous beaches that are ideal for romantic as well as fun-filled beachside family vacations. Besides sightseeing, tourists can indulge in shopping in Princes Street, dining in pedestrian precincts, lounging in English pubs and more. About Birmingham (BHX)

Birmingham is Britain's second but the largest city located in West Midlands. This city has been popular in the Victorian era as the ‘City of 1000 Trades’ and the ‘Workshop of the World’. The city is one of the biggest industrial centres in the whole world. Birmingham is popularly known as ‘Brum’. Presently the city is a major international commercial centre which is ranked as a beta-world city by the globalization and world cities research network. It is a major transport, retail, events and conference hub globally. Eye-catching sightseeing in Birmingham is a big business as there are plenty of famous tourist attractions that will magnetize you with your first glance. You can hire guided bus tours that would show the city and offer you in-depth information about all attractions. Nature lovers will surely love this place as it is surrounded by number of famous parks like Birmingham Botanical Gardens & Glasshouses, Birmingham Nature Centre, Cannon Hill Park, Lickey Hills Country Park, National Sea Life Centre, RSPB Sandwell Valley, Woodgate Valley Country Park and many others. If you are planning to visit Birmingham then enjoy its famous events, exhibitions and conferences which include National Exhibition Centre (NEC), National Indoor Arena (NIA), and International Convention Centre (ICC) and so on. Its vibrant night life attracts thousands of visitors every years and is mainly concerted along Broad Street and in Brindley place. St Philip's Cathedral, St Martin's Church, St Chad's Church, National Indoor Arena, City Museum and Art Gallery, Chamberlain Square, Victoria Square and many others are some of the major tourist attractions that lure large number of travellers from all across the country.
